Kiwi doubles trio all in ATP action tonight

Tuesday, 27 October 2020

Michael Venus and John Peers begin their campaign overnight at the ATP 500 tournament in Vienna. They take on French Open champions Andreas Mies and Kevin Krawietz in their first round match.

A win for the antipodean duo would take them to the cusp of qualifying for the lucrative season ending ATP finals in London. Their opponents are also in superb form having won Roland Garros for the second straight year and reached the final last weekend in the ATP tournament Cologne. The Germans have already booked their spot in the field for London.

“Everyone’s playing here and trying to get in as many matches in before hopefully qualifying for London. So it’s going to be a tough match. They have won French Open two years in a row and made semi-finals at US Open last year so are playing well and have a lot of confidence.” Venus said.

Marcus Daniell and Artem Sitak are also in action tonight at the ATP 250 tournament in Nur-Sultan in Kazakhstan.

Daniell and his Austrian partner Philipp Oswald meet Britain’s Dominic Inglot and Pakistan’s Aisam-ul-Haq Qureshi followed by Sitak and Dutchman Sander Arends against Serbian Nikola Cacic and Brazil’s Marcelo Demoliner.
